The 2026 event is shaping up to be the biggest, brightest, most fabulous edition yet, packing 12 days full of queer joy, bold visibility and community vibes.

From humble 2016 beginnings to its growth as a headline event in the WA calendar, Albany Pride Festival is powerful and deeply meaningful. And in 2026, it's a celebration of not only a decade of the event, but also the Albany/Kinjarling Bicentenary with the guidance and partnership of Menang Noongar Elders and community leaders.

Albany Pride Festival is a love letter to regional LGBTQIA+ communities, a celebration of queer identity, and a gathering which uplifts, connects, and aims to make every person feel seen.

Albany Pride Festival aligns with the WA Labour Day long weekend, and leads into the City Of Albany's huge commemorative event Lighting The Sound. So what are you waiting for?! The programme is simply overflowing with iconic favourites, new queer delights, and plenty of community magic. There's classics like Fairday, the dog show, Drag Bingo with BarbieQ, the Bi+ Picnic, and loads of family-friendly fun.

Plus, Live At The Town Hall: Queer Edition celebrates its premiere, and audiences can enjoy striking visual exhibitions A Decade Of Pride and The 82 Abettors Of The Zeewyijk.

The Barn Dance makes its return in 2026, and on the sports side of things you can check out – among other stuff – the Great Southern Football League Women's Pride Round.

Albany Pride Festival is on from 19 February-2 March.
